Full Job Description
Job Purpose:

Provides high quality credit analysis and underwriting with proper identification and evaluation of credit risks and mitigants for larger and more complex loan requests. Complies with established processes, quality standards and responsiveness expectations. Evaluates credit requests, structure and loan codes. Provides guidance and coaching to less experienced credit analysts and underwriters.

Job Duties:
  • Underwrites larger and more complex loan requests to meet customer and prospect needs while also best protecting bank.
  • Performs high quality credit analysis and underwriting to ensure credit risks are identified and adequately mitigated including but not limited to repayment sources, collateral coverage and industry impact.
  • Evaluates credit requests and structure.
  • Complies with established processes, quality standards and responsiveness expectations.
  • Validates loan codes within loan packages to ensure accuracy.
  • Provides guidance and coaching to less experienced credit analysts and underwriters for continuous growth and bench strength.
  • Participates in Pre-Flight discussions and memorializes takeaways.
  • Builds out loan request details within loan origination system in conjunction with commercial banking portfolio managers.
  • Performs appraisal review and evaluation if applicable.
  • Validates risk ratings and requests changes if warranted.
  • Adheres to bank's policies and procedures and complies with regulatory requirements.
  • Will perform special projects as assigned.
